Different types of solar lawn lights, including string lights, stake lights, and post lights, serve unique purposes, such as creating atmospheric effects or providing functional, permanent lighting. String lights are ideal for walkways and garden borders, offering a whimsical and easy-to-install option. Stake lights are perfect for quick, no-dig installations, making them suitable for defining paths and bordering lawns. Post lights, being more permanent, are effective in lighting up larger areas and can serve as excellent focal points for landscape features. Light control and sensors, such as light, temperature, and moisture sensors, can further enhance functionality and energy efficiency. Smart timers can be programmed to turn lights on at dusk and off at dawn, and adaptive settings can further optimize energy use. Energy efficiency and lifespan are critical when selecting solar lawn lights. High-wattage solar panels with fast charging rates ensure consistent brightness and reliable performance even on cloudy days. Opting for LED lights with a minimum lifespan of 50,000 hours and using lithium-ion batteries for durability and low maintenance are essential. Proper placement under taller plants or trees can enhance both aesthetics and energy efficiency by diffusing light and maximizing charging potential. Regular maintenance, including cleaning panels every 3 to 6 months using soft brushes or gentle water sprays, can significantly extend the lifespan and overall performance of the solar lights. This ensures they remain effective and cost-efficient over time.
When installing solar lawn lights, focus on maximizing sunlight exposure by placing them in areas with at least 6 hours of unobstructed sunlight, such as near shorter deciduous trees or in open spaces. Proper installation involves ensuring that lights are not too close to each other to avoid overlapping shadows and that smart timers and sensors are used for efficient energy management. Regular maintenance is essential to keep solar panels and batteries performing optimally. This includes cleaning panels every 3 to 6 months using soft brushes or gentle water sprays, avoiding harsh chemicals. Adjust panel angles seasonally for optimal sunlight exposure, and use snow-sensitive panels to reduce the effects of snow and ice coverage. Regular checks for panel alignment, battery health indicators, and proper sensor calibration are crucial for maintaining the systems reliability and extending its lifespan.
When considering solar and traditional lawn lights, several key factors come into play. Solar lights have seen significant advancements in battery technology, offering longer charge times and better performance even on cloudy days, which enhances both their reliability and longevity. This makes them an increasingly viable alternative to traditional options, which often require routine maintenance such as replacing bulbs and ensuring proper wiring. While traditional lights provide consistent, high-intensity illumination, they are more labor-intensive to install and maintain, particularly in areas without easy access to electricity. Additionally, solar lights offer a natural, softer glow that can create a more serene ambiance, fitting well with a moonlit, organic landscape. The flexibility of placement in solar lights also adds to their allure, as they can be installed almost anywhere without cumbersome wiring requirements. Ultimately, the choice between solar and traditional lights depends on the specific needs of the garden or landscape, balancing aesthetic and functional requirements with maintenance considerations and environmental benefits.
